public TransactionManager(IFileConvertFactory <TransactionRequest> factory, IWatcher watcher, IDALTransactionManager manager) : base(factory, watcher) { _manager = manager ?? throw new ArgumentNullException(nameof(manager)); }
protected ManagerBase(IFileConvertFactory <TEntity> factory, IWatcher watcher) { _watcher = watcher ?? throw new ArgumentNullException(nameof(watcher)); _factory = factory ?? throw new ArgumentNullException(nameof(factory)); }